Discovering Different Tattoo Styles

The art of body ink is vast and varied, with styles that span from the classic and heavy to the delicate and modern. Knowing these different genres can make it easier to choose your preferences. Every genre has its own special character and origin.

Classic and Timeless Designs

Frequently referred to as classic tattoos, this style is characterized by strong, clean lines and a limited color palette, typically featuring reds, greens, yellows, and blacks. Popular subjects are roses, anchors, eagles, and skulls. These matching tattoo ideas for twins are famous for their clarity over time, looking fantastic for decades.

Understated and Structured Tattoos

If you appreciate a more understated look, minimalist tattoos are an excellent choice. This style is all about fine lines, simple shapes, and negative space. Geometric tattoos fall into this category, using precise lines and shapes like circles, triangles, and mandalas to create appealing matching tattoo ideas for twins. They are perfect for a discreet yet meaningful piece of art.

Vibrant Watercolor Styles

A more contemporary trend, watercolor tattoos replicate the look of a painting. They are known for soft color blending, splatters, and a an absence of solid black outlines. This technique creates a very dynamic and expressive effect on the skin. It's a fantastic option for floral designs, animals, and abstract matching tattoo ideas for twins.
